WEB.API Core, серверный запрос к Microsoft Graph или Outlook - PullRequest
0 голосов
/ 11 января 2019

Существует три способа отправки электронной почты через Outlook в WEB.API Core.

  1. Я могу напрямую использовать запрос JSon для Microsoft Graph API или для Outlook API напрямую;

  2. Я могу использовать библиотеку Microsoft.Graph;

  3. Я могу отправить в WEB.API Core из программы Outlook в компьютер.

В первых двух ситуациях я должен вручную войти в браузер. Третий способ меня не устраивает, потому что на сервере не может быть программы Outlook.

Можно ли получить авторизацию и аутентификацию без браузера непосредственно с моего сервера?

Ответы [ 2 ]

0 голосов
/ 14 января 2019

Вы можете использовать Поток предоставления клиентских учетных данных , в этом случае ваш веб-интерфейс будет вызывать Microsoft Graph для отправки электронных писем с собственной идентификационной информацией, а не от имени пользователя, а затем без процесса входа в систему:

Получить доступ без пользователя с помощью Microsoft Graph

0 голосов
/ 11 января 2019

Мое решение для отправки электронной почты, как из Outlook, - я должен взаимодействовать с веб-службой Exchange. Так что это то, что я ищу. Это четвертый способ взаимодействия с Outlook. И лучшим воплощением для этого является пакет Microsoft.Exchange.WebServices.NETStandard.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...